How Our Commercial Water Removal Process Works
When you call us for Commercial Water Removal, our team will arrive quickly and assess the damage. We’ll then walk you through our step-by-step process, which includes:
Step 1: Water Extraction
Our Technicians Use Powerful Pumps to remove standing water from your property. This is a crucial step in pre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
We Use Industrial-Grade Dehumidifiers to dry your property and remove excess moisture. This ensures that your property is safe and dry.
Step 3: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Our Team Uses Eco-Friendly Cleaning Products to sanitize and disinfect your property, removing any bacteria or contaminants.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
We Work with You to Repair and Restore your property to its original condition. This includes repairing damaged walls, floors, and ceilings.

Commercial Water Removal Cost In Kent, WA
The cost of Commercial Water Removal in Kent,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common Commercial Water Removal services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Repair and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ed |
| Commercial Roof Repair | $5,000 – $20,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ed |
| Commercial Floor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and can help you navigate the process.
